THE NATURALIST
This simple, natural vibe translates Christmas just fine. The use of natural elements and simplicity can read both modern and transitional, but above all, easy elegance. Sometimes, less is more, especially with Christmas decor.

BLACK AND WHITE
We’re total suckers for black and white mantels. Crisp, clean, and fresh. When the holidays are over, replace the “Merry Christmas” with a simple, winter saying, and remove the stockings and countdown to Christmas sign, and voila! You’re ready for the rest of winter.

CLASSIC CHRISTMAS
For those of us inclined towards traditional decor, red is always right, and it can be your default, no matter what color scheme you have going on in your home! Red speaks to the tradition of the season, and infusing your space with red is always a win, when done right.
